Login / Signup
Cart
Your cart is empty
This is a dual Gigabit ethernet 5G/4G base board from Waveshare, designed for the Raspberry Pi Compute Module 4 (not included).
This base board's main features are the dual-Gigabit Ethernet ports, allowing you to evaluate the CM4 as a controller for a custom router project. You'll need to compile your own software for this with very limited information from the manufacturer, so this is not intended for novice users!
There's also a slot for an M.2 B-Key 4G/5G module (not included) allowing the addition of LTE functionality for your project. Alongside this is a nano sim card slot option 5G/4G/3G/2G connectivity as well.
The board also features 2x USB 3.2 ports, an RTC and backup battery holder, fan header, 2x CSI ports for camera modules, 1x DSI port for DSI displays, 2 full-size HDMI ports and a Micro-SD card slot!
Base board only. Does not include the CM4, power supply or M.2 B-Key module. This allows you to choose your wireless and power options separately.
1) CM4 socket
- suitable for all variants of Compute Module 4
2) 40-Pin GPIO header
- For connecting sorts of HATs
3) Dual RJ45 Gigabit Ethernet
- 10/100/1000M compatible
- ETHERNET 0: CM4 original ETH
- ETHERNET 1: USB extended ETH
4) HDMI connectors
- 2x HDMI, supports 4K 30fps output
5) USB 3.2 ports
- 2x USB 3.2 Gen1, for connecting sorts of USB devices
6) PWR & USB
- DC power supply or USB programming port
7) Fan header
- For connecting cooling fan, allows speed adjustment and measurement
8) Camera Port
- 2x MIPI CSI camera ports
9) 4G/5G module status indicator
- STA red: module enable indicator
- NET green: module operating status indicator
10) CM4 status indicator
- PWR red: Raspberry Pi power indicator
- ACT green: Raspberry Pi operating status indicator
11) BOOT selection
- ON: CM4 will be booted from USB-C interface
- OFF: CM4 will be booted from eMMC or Micro SD card
12) Display Port
- MIPI DSI display port
13) M.2 B KEY
- Supports 4G/5G modules, or other communication modules using USB channel
14) Nano-SIM card slot
- Supports standard Nano-SIM card for 5G/4G/3G/2G communication
15) Micro SD card slot
- For connecting a Micro SD card with pre-burnt image (Lite variant ONLY)
16) RTC battery holder
- Supports CR2032 button cell
17) RTC interruption configuration
- PI-RUN: CM4 will reboot on RTC interruption
- GL-EN: CM4 powerdown on RTC interruption
- D4: D4 pin is triggered on RTC interruption (default)
18) IO-VREF selection
- Set the CM4 IO logic level as 3.3V (default) or 1.8V
19) Fan power supply selection
- Select 12V (default) or 5V power to drive the fan
20) RTC/FAN I2C bus selection
- SDA0/SCL0: I2C-10 is shared with CSI/DSI (default)
- GPIO3/2: I2C-1 is shared with 40-pin header
21) System function configuration
- BT_DIS: Bluetooth disabled, for CM4 with antenna variant ONLY
- WiFi_DIS: WiFi disabled, for CM4 with antenna variant ONLY
- WP_DIS: boot mode switch, ONLY be used when NOT booted from eMMC or SD card
22) RTL8153
- USB Gigabit Ethernet chip
CM4 Socket | Suitable for all variants of Compute Module 4 |
Networking | Dual Gigabit Ethernet RJ45 M.2 B KEY, for connecting 5G / 4G module Nano-SIM card slot, supports Nano-SIM card for 5G/4G/3G/2G |
USB | USB 3.2 Gen1 × 2 |
Pin Header | Raspberry Pi 40-pin GPIO header |
Display | MIPI DSI port (15pin 1.0mm FPC connector) |
Camera | MIPI CSI-2 port × 2 (15pin 1.0mm FPC connector) |
Video | HDMI × 2, supports 4K 30fps output |
RTC | Real-time clock with a battery socket and ability to wake CM4 |
Storagre | MicroSD card socket for Compute Module 4 Lite (without eMMC) variants |
Fan Header | 5V/12V (12V by default), allows speed adjustment and measurement |
Power Input | 5V/2.5A |
Dimensions | 99.6 × 87.0mm |
CM4, power supply and M.2 B-key communication module not included